When we mention dipped beam light bulbs on your Renault Grand Espace, we also talk about H7 bulbs, this is in fact the “technical” name of this bulb. Here are the different sort of bulbs that can be found and their advantages:

  • Halogen low beam bulb Renault Grand Espace: This first sort of bulb has multiple advantages, they are appropriate for all budgets because they are the most accessible bulbs. Halogen low beam bulbs for your car have the benefit of having a powerful and precise beam but tend to produce a yellow light that tires the eyes rapidly. Additionally, they have a modest life span and can burn out quite quickly for no reason.

  • LED low beam bulb:
    Changing the low beam bulb of your car to LED, there will be many interests to switch to this kind of technology for motorists. In actual fact, a LED bulb will firstly deliver a powerful white light that does not tire the eyes, additionally it will have a very long life, you may change Renault Grand Espace before you need to change bulb, to finish the energy consumption is very low, a forgotten headlight will have less outcomes than with conventional bulbs. On the flip side, you should know that the purchase price will be more expensive and that on some models you will need an adapter to be able to install them.

How to change the low beam bulb on your Renault Grand Espace

Now let’s move on to the part that probably interests you the most, how to change the low beam bulb on my Renault Grand Espace, to change this bulb know that there are not 10,000 ways. In actual fact, we will outline the few steps to be conducted, but be aware that on some years or finishes, access to the low beam bulb on your automobile can be very challenging and will need the help of a professional:

  • To change a low beam bulb on your Renault Grand Espace, you’ll have to open the hood of the bulb.
  • Find the access hatch to your optical block
  • You will then have to clear the access of this one, that’s where it gets challenging on some series, the access is sometimes complex and making room by removing the parts that obstruct may seem too challenging. Generally, one side is easy and the other is more complicated.
  • Once you’ve accessed the hatch, all you have to do is open it, take out your old bulb and change the low beam bulb on your car
  • Be sure you put everything back in place, remembering to put everything you moved to access the headlight block of your car
